Training
a. PURPOSE
The purpose of this procedure is to ensure that the training needs of all staff in the
company whose work affects quality are identified and that suitable training is provided
accordingly.
b. SCOPE OF APPLICATION
This procedure applies to all departments within the company.
c. DEFINITIONS
Induction training: means: introductory training provided to each new employee on
commencement of employment.
d. CROSS REFERENCE
Quality manual, clause d.18
e. RESPONSIBILITY FOR APPLICATION
The general manager, management representative and department managers/project
engineers are jointly responsible, at varying intervals, for the application of this
procedure.
f. PROCESS
f.1 Copies of staff qualifications and /or training certificates, or where these do not
exist, copies of curriculum vitae, resuming form, passport withdrawal, new
employee joining report, ordinary leave form, appointment order, report of
performance, percentage of worker of various trade, memo, time off request.(or
similar) will be kept in individual personnel files together with each persons training
record form. These files will be maintained by the public relation officer.
f.2 The general manager will arrange for all new employees whose function affects
quality to attend induction training. Assistance on technical aspects may be sought
from other relevant personnel where required. Induction training shall include the
following:
Introduction to the company’s quality policy and quality system.
Issue of relevant quality system documents where required.
Instruction on the organization and its internal rules.
Introduction to job requirements, responsibility and authority.
Introduction to staff, and facilities orientation.
Identification of any required training.
The general manager shall enter such details on the training record for the
individual concerned. Training requirements identified at this stage shall be
handled in accordance with clause f.6 below.
